1926 1pi and 2pi Railway Issue, tied by Djedda (17.2.26) pmk on cover to Mrs. Philby in England, with Port Taufiq transit pmk on back, two archival pinholes at bottom of cover, which has been refolded at top (sender of this cover, Harry St John Bridger Philby, a British Arabist, adviser, explorer, writer, and colonial office intelligence officer. He converted to Islam in 1930, and later became an adviser to Ibn Saud, urging him to become King of the whole of Arabia and helping him to negotiate with both England and the United States when petroleum was discovered in 1938. His only son by his first wife Dora Johnston was Kim Philby, who became known worldwide as a double agent for the Soviet Union, where he defected in 1963) (Cat No. 51,52) (Image)
